Foundation repair services involve assessing and fixing issues related to a building’s underlying support system. Over time, factors such as soil movement, moisture changes, or poor initial construction can cause the foundation to settle, crack, or shift. Skilled contractors use a variety of techniques to stabilize and reinforce the foundation, ensuring the structure remains safe and level. These services often include foundation underpinning, piering, or slab stabilization, all aimed at restoring the integrity of the property’s base.

Many common problems signal the need for foundation repair. Visible cracks in walls or floors, doors and windows that no longer close properly, uneven flooring, or noticeable sinking are signs of shifting or settling. These issues can lead to further structural damage if not addressed promptly. Homeowners experiencing such symptoms should consider consulting local contractors who specialize in foundation repair to evaluate the situation and recommend appropriate solutions.

Foundation repair is applicable to a variety of property types, including single-family homes, townhouses, and small commercial buildings. Homes built on expansive clay soils or in areas with significant moisture fluctuations are particularly vulnerable to foundation movement. What are common signs of foundation problems?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, doors and windows that stick or don’t close properly, and gaps around window frames or exterior doors.

How do professionals typically repair foundation issues? They may use methods such as underpinning, pier and beam systems, or slab jacking to stabilize and lift the foundation back to its proper position.

What factors can lead to foundation damage? Factors include soil movement, poor drainage, plumbing leaks, or previous construction issues that compromise the stability of the foundation.

Are foundation repairs necessary for minor cracks? While small cracks may not always require extensive repairs, a professional assessment can determine if they indicate a larger issue needing attention.
